We developed and characterized an especially designed stator for a 50 kW class high-temperature superconducting induction/synchronous motor (HTS-ISM). The so-called ring windings are introduced for the stator in order to increase the critical current in the iron slots. DC and ac current transport tests are carried out in liquid nitrogen (77 K). It is found that the stator can carry a large dc current and show adequately small ac loss at low frequencies. Our report shows the possibility of the further improvements of efficiency and torque density in fully HTS-ISM.
